While this question has been answered _very_ clearly, I think it's important to also consider that some Japanese animations have been largely influenced by american cartoons (as does the opposite apply) yet despite these "influences" the titles still remain quite clear - Anime = 2D animation of Japanese origin; Cartoon = 2D animation of English-speaking origin ...... At least, that's the way I've always interpreted it :P
